Take a deep dive into the past as we bring you the very best of BBC History Magazine, Britain’s bestselling history magazine. With a new episode released every Monday, enjoy fascinating and enlightening articles from leading historical experts, covering a broad sweep of the centuries – from the scandals of Georgian society to the horrors of the First World War, revolutions, rebellions, and more.

What is HistoryExtra Long Reads about and what kind of topics does it cover?

This podcast presents a comprehensive exploration of significant historical events and figures through the lens of detailed narratives and expert commentary. Each episode focuses on a different topic, such as Victorian boxing, notable historical figures like Julius Caesar, and complex societal issues like the witch hunts in Scotland, reflecting a wide range of themes across various eras. Noteworthy discussions include the impacts of cultural phenomena like Live Aid and critical analyses of historical events, driven by well-researched articles from leading historians. Unique in its format, the podcast emphasizes in-depth storytelling and can serve as both an educational tool and a source of entertainment for history enthusiasts.
